Description

The Authority is seeking to evaluate the capability of suppliers to develop a prototype Laser Warning Device (LWD) for dismounted users. The LWD must be low size, weight and power (e.g. could be body-worn) to support dismounted users in the detection of a wide range of battlefield laser threats.
